Return the retirement age of Prison Officers to 60. 68 is too late.

Our prisons are dangerous, high stress environments. Working in them is physically, mentally and emotionally demanding, often requiring physical interventions against some of societies most violent men and women. It is not feasible to continue working to 68. Return the retirement age to 60.

This petition closed on 6 Nov 2019 with 7,121 signatures
